#6ce858 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6ce858 is composed of 42.4% red, 91%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.1%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 111.7 degrees, a saturation of 75.8% and a lightness of 62.7%. #6ce858 color hex could be obtained by blending #d8ffb0 with #00d100. Closest websafe color is: #66ff66.

Shades and Tints of #6ce858

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010501 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6ce858

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9ca69a is the less saturated color, while #5cfe42 is the most saturated one.
